diff --git a/libavcodec/avuidec.c b/libavcodec/avuidec.c
new file mode 100644
index 0000000..88f3685
--- /dev/null
+++ b/libavcodec/avuidec.c
@@ -0,0 +1,132 @@
+/*
+ * AVID Meridien decoder

+
+#include "libavutil/common.h"
+#include "libavutil/intreadwrite.h"
+
+#include "avcodec.h"
+#include "internal.h"
+
+static av_cold int avui_decode_init(AVCodecContext *avctx)
+{
+    avctx->pix_fmt = AV_PIX_FMT_YUVA422P;
+    return 0;
+}
+
+static int avui_decode_frame(AVCodecContext *avctx, void *data,
+                             int *got_frame, AVPacket *avpkt)
+{
+    int ret;
+    AVFrame *pic = data;
+    const uint8_t *src = avpkt->data, *extradata = avctx->extradata;
+    const uint8_t *srca;
+    uint8_t *y, *u, *v, *a;
+    int transparent, interlaced = 1, skip, opaque_length, i, j, k;
+    uint32_t extradata_size = avctx->extradata_size;
+
+    while (extradata_size >= 24) {
+        uint32_t atom_size = AV_RB32(extradata);
+        if (!memcmp(&extradata[4], "APRGAPRG0001", 12)) {
+            interlaced = extradata[19] != 1;
+            break;
+        }
+        if (atom_size && atom_size <= extradata_size) {
+            extradata      += atom_size;
+            extradata_size -= atom_size;
+        } else {
+            break;
+        }
+    }
+    if (avctx->height == 486) {
+        skip = 10;
+    } else {
+        skip = 16;
+    }
+    opaque_length = 2 * avctx->width * (avctx->height + skip) + 4 * interlaced;
+    if (avpkt->size < opaque_length) {
+        av_log(avctx, AV_LOG_ERROR, "Insufficient input data.\n");
+        return AVERROR(EINVAL);
+    }
+    transparent = avctx->bits_per_coded_sample == 32 &&
+                  avpkt->size >= opaque_length * 2 + 4;
+    srca = src + opaque_length + 5;
+
+    if ((ret = ff_get_buffer(avctx, pic, 0)) < 0)
+        return ret;
+
+    pic->key_frame = 1;
+    pic->pict_type = AV_PICTURE_TYPE_I;
+
+    if (!interlaced) {
+        src  += avctx->width * skip;
+        srca += avctx->width * skip;
+    }
+
+    for (i = 0; i < interlaced + 1; i++) {
+        src  += avctx->width * skip;
+        srca += avctx->width * skip;
+        if (interlaced && avctx->height == 486) {
+            y = pic->data[0] + (1 - i) * pic->linesize[0];
+            u = pic->data[1] + (1 - i) * pic->linesize[1];
+            v = pic->data[2] + (1 - i) * pic->linesize[2];
+            a = pic->data[3] + (1 - i) * pic->linesize[3];
+        } else {
+            y = pic->data[0] + i * pic->linesize[0];
+            u = pic->data[1] + i * pic->linesize[1];
+            v = pic->data[2] + i * pic->linesize[2];
+            a = pic->data[3] + i * pic->linesize[3];
+        }
+
+        for (j = 0; j < avctx->height >> interlaced; j++) {
+            for (k = 0; k < avctx->width >> 1; k++) {
+                u[    k    ] = *src++;
+                y[2 * k    ] = *src++;
+                a[2 * k    ] = 0xFF - (transparent ? *srca++ : 0);
+                srca++;
+                v[    k    ] = *src++;
+                y[2 * k + 1] = *src++;
+                a[2 * k + 1] = 0xFF - (transparent ? *srca++ : 0);
+                srca++;
+            }
+
+            y += (interlaced + 1) * pic->linesize[0];
+            u += (interlaced + 1) * pic->linesize[1];
+            v += (interlaced + 1) * pic->linesize[2];
+            a += (interlaced + 1) * pic->linesize[3];
+        }
+        src  += 4;
+        srca += 4;
+    }
+    *got_frame = 1;
+
+    return avpkt->size;
+}
+
+AVCodec ff_avui_decoder = {
+    .name         = "avui",
+    .long_name    = NULL_IF_CONFIG_SMALL("Avid Meridien Uncompressed"),
+    .type         = AVMEDIA_TYPE_VIDEO,
+    .id           = AV_CODEC_ID_AVUI,
+    .init         = avui_decode_init,
+    .decode       = avui_decode_frame,
+    .capabilities = CODEC_CAP_DR1,
+};
